Seite 1 von 1

user anlegen nicht möglich

Verfasst: Do 25. Mär 2004, 10:11
von #ayshe
Hallo,

ich mache gerade meine ersten Schritte mit C 4.4.2 und bitte daher schonmal um Nachsicht wegen meiner Frage ;-)

Die Installation hat prima geklappt, aber nun möchte ich Adminbereich einen neuen User anlegen. Ich fülle also alle relevanten Felder (Username, Name, Passwort, Passowortwiederholung) aus, markiere noch "WYSIWYG-Editor benutzen" und bestätige das Ganze mit dem grünen Button.
Was passiert dann? Der Screen zuckt mal kurz, das Formular ist wieder leer und in der Userliste links hat sich nichts verändert :shock:
Mir ist noch aufgefallen, dass es in der MySQL DB zwar eine Tabelle "_user_prop" gibt, nicht aber "_user". Vielleicht ist bei der Installation doch was schief gelaufen?

Ahoi,
#ayshe

Verfasst: Do 25. Mär 2004, 10:18
von emergence
die con_user gibts auch nicht... die benutzer werden in der
con_phplib_auth_user_md5 gespeichert.
steht was im contenido/logs/errorlog.txt ?

Verfasst: Do 25. Mär 2004, 11:06
von #ayshe
Jau, da steht was drin (und zwar etwas, was ich nicht verstehe...):

Code: Alles auswählen

[25-Mrz-2004 09:34:49] Invalid SQL: INSERT INTO

                        _phplib_auth_user_md5

                      SET

            		    username="Ayshe",

                        password="ee11cbb19052e40b07aac0ca060c23ee",

                        realname="Ayshe",

                        email="user@localhost",

                        telephone="",

                        address_street="",

                        address_city="",

                        address_country="",

    	        	    address_zip="",

                        wysi="1",

                        perms="",

    		            user_id="224bf8f82ae12daa8f16ef9bc949e333"<br><br>
[25-Mrz-2004 09:57:47] Invalid SQL: INSERT INTO

                        _phplib_auth_user_md5

                      SET

            		    username="Ayshe",

                        password="24c9e15e52afc47c225b757e7bee1f9d",

                        realname="Ayshe",

                        email="",

                        telephone="",

                        address_street="",

                        address_city="",

                        address_country="",

    	        	    address_zip="",

                        wysi="1",

                        perms="admin[1],client[1]",

    		            user_id="224bf8f82ae12daa8f16ef9bc949e333"<br><br>
Was bedeutet das?

Verfasst: Do 25. Mär 2004, 11:37
von timo
kopier dir mal das SQL-Statement in den phpMyAdmin und sag uns, was die Fehlermeldung ist.

Verfasst: Do 25. Mär 2004, 11:47
von #ayshe
MySQL said:

Duplicate entry '224bf8f82ae12daa8f16ef9bc949e333' for key 1

Verfasst: Do 25. Mär 2004, 12:00
von timo
dann gibt es bereits einen Benutzer im System, der genau denselben Benutzernamen hat.

Verfasst: Do 25. Mär 2004, 12:11
von #ayshe
Ja, vom ersten Versuch, den User anzulegen. Aber warum ist er in der DB, wird aber dennoch nicht im Admin angzeigt?

#ayshe

Verfasst: Do 25. Mär 2004, 12:57
von timo
weil der admin nur die user sieht, die zu seinem mandanten gehören. logg dich als sysadmin ein, dann wirst du ihn sehen.

Verfasst: Do 25. Mär 2004, 13:14
von #ayshe
aha! Login für den Sysadmin ist bei ungeänderter Installation welcher? (admin/admin ist dann ja offenbar nur der kunden-admin)

#ayshe

Verfasst: Do 25. Mär 2004, 13:17
von emergence
sysadmin/sysadmin

Verfasst: Do 25. Mär 2004, 13:52
von #ayshe
Vielen Dank für die schnelle Hilfe! :-)